And the variety? It's mind-blowing. Given Miami's coastal charm, it's no surprise that seafood trucks are a massive hit. Imagine fresh fish tacos or blackened mahi-mahi bowls right by the beach – it’s practically a Miami rite of passage. Then you have these incredibly creative Mexican-Southern fusion trucks, blending spicy Mexican flavors with comforting Southern staples. Think pulled pork tacos with a side of collard greens, or brisket nachos that are just pure indulgence. It’s a testament to Miami's diverse palate and adventurous eaters.

For those looking for something a bit lighter or quicker, the sandwich and salad trucks are lifesavers, especially during the weekday lunch rush in business districts. They offer everything from Cuban-inspired paninis to healthy grain bowls, catering to busy professionals and fitness enthusiasts alike. And who can resist the showmanship of a hibachi and Japanese grill truck? Watching your meal sizzle and cook right in front of you adds a whole layer of entertainment, making it a hit for families and anyone looking for a fun dining experience.

Of course, we can't forget the sweet side of things. Dessert trucks are everywhere, satisfying those cravings with everything from artisanal ice cream and churros to delicate crepes and cupcakes. They're perfect for festivals, weddings, or just a spontaneous treat. Many are even offering vegan and gluten-free options, showing how adaptable and inclusive the food truck scene has become.
